Examining your image in a convex mirror whose radius of curvature is 24.6 centimeter, you stand with the tip of your nose 9.60 centimeter from the surface of the mirror.

Part A. Compute where is the image of your nose located.

Part B. Compute what is its magnification.

Part C. Your ear is 10 centimeter behind the tip of your nose, compute where is the image your ear located.

Part D. Compute what is its magnification.
